如何利用ADT连接MySQL数据库(adt怎么连接mysql)

如何利用ADT连接MySQL数据库

ADT(Android Development Tools)是安卓开发工具的集合,其中包括了Eclipse集成开发环境和Android SDK。MySQL是世界上最流行的开放源代码数据库系统之一。将ADT与MySQL数据库连接起来,可以为Android开发提供强大的数据支持。本文将介绍如何利用ADT连接MySQL数据库。

步骤一:安装MySQL Connector/J

MySQL Connector/J是MySQL提供的一个Java数据库连接API。它可以让Java程序连接到MySQL数据库并执行各种操作。在连接MySQL数据库之前,需要先下载并安装MySQL Connector/J。

步骤二:创建数据库

在MySQL数据库中创建一个新的数据库,并命名为“testdb”。这个数据库将用于存储Android应用程序的数据。

步骤三:创建数据表

使用以下代码创建一个名为“users”的数据表:

CREATE TABLE `users` (

`id` int(11) NOT NULL AUTO_INCREMENT,

`name` varchar(50) NOT NULL DEFAULT ”,

`eml` varchar(50) NOT NULL DEFAULT ”,

`password` varchar(50) NOT NULL DEFAULT ”,

PRIMARY KEY (`id`)

) ENGINE=InnoDB DEFAULT CHARSET=utf8;

该数据表包含四个字段:id、name、eml和password。其中,id字段是自增长的主键,用于唯一标识每个用户。

步骤四:编写Java代码

下面是一个简单的Java代码示例,用于连接到MySQL数据库并向数据表中插入一条新的记录:

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.PreparedStatement;

import java.sql.SQLException;

public class MySQLAccess {

private Connection connect = null;

private PreparedStatement preparedStatement = null;

public void insertUser(String name, String eml, String password) throws Exception {

try {

//加载MySQL驱动程序

Class.forName(“com.mysql.jdbc.Driver”);

//连接MySQL数据库

connect = DriverManager.getConnection(“jdbc:mysql://localhost:3306/testdb?” +

“user=root&password=rootpassword”);

//准备SQL语句

preparedStatement = connect.prepareStatement(“insert into users (name,eml,password) values (?, ?, ?)”);

preparedStatement.setString(1, name);

preparedStatement.setString(2, eml);

preparedStatement.setString(3, password);

//执行SQL语句,并获取插入的记录数

int count = preparedStatement.executeUpdate();

System.out.println(count + ” records inserted.”);

} catch (SQLException e) {

throw e;

} finally {

close();

}

}

private void close() {

try {

if (preparedStatement != null) {

preparedStatement.close();

}

if (connect != null) {

connect.close();

}

} catch (Exception e) {

}

}

}

在该代码中,我们首先加载了MySQL驱动程序,然后连接到MySQL数据库,并准备一条SQL语句来插入一条新的记录。最后执行SQL语句,并获取插入的记录数。

步骤五:测试代码

将上面的Java代码保存为MySQLAccess.java,并编译运行。如果一切正常,代码将连接到MySQL数据库,并向“users”数据表中插入一条新的记录。

总结

本文介绍了如何利用ADT连接MySQL数据库。需要安装MySQL Connector/J,并在MySQL数据库中创建一个新的数据库和数据表。然后,编写Java代码以连接到MySQL数据库并执行各种操作。测试代码是否工作正常。使用这个方法可以帮助你快速建立强大的数据支持系统,为安卓应用程序提供更好的用户体验。


数据运维技术 » 如何利用ADT连接MySQL数据库(adt怎么连接mysql)